HUMANOIDS: Self-directed robots invented to serve & guard mankind
"With Folded Hands" is a 1947 sf novelette by Jack Williamson (1908–2006). His influence for this story was in the aftermath of WWII & the atomic bombings of Japan & his concern that "some of the technological creations we had developed with the best intentions might have disastrous consequences in the long run." The story was followed by a novel-length rewrite, with a different setting & inventor. This, serialized as ...& Searching Mind, was finally published as The Humanoids (1948). He followed with a sequel, The Humanoid Touch, published in 1980.
